Fly into Liberia International Airport, then take a 1-hour drive to Playa Grande. Alternatively, domestic travellers can drive directly, approximately 4 hours from San Jose. No direct public transport or water routes available.
The most convenient airport for both domestic and international travellers is Liberia International Airport, due to its proximity and frequent flights. It's approximately 65km from Playa Grande, Costa Rica.
Playa Grande, Costa Rica, lacks public transport. However, walking is feasible due to the town's compact size. Cycling is another popular option, with bike rentals available. For longer distances, hiring a car or using a taxi service is recommended. Always remember to check current road conditions and local driving laws.
The Palm Beach Estates neighbourhood in Playa Grande, Costa Rica, is a top choice for visitors. It offers close proximity to the beach, restaurants, and shops, making it a convenient and popular area to stay.
Playa Grande, Costa Rica, enjoys a tropical climate with average temperatures ranging from 22°C to 33°C throughout the year. There are no distinct summer and winter seasons. However, it has a dry season from December to April and a wet season from May to November. Despite being in the hurricane belt, it rarely experiences hurricanes.

I liked the area, which is a very long beach near the national park. Note that access can be limited, as it is a very bumpy and unpaved road from the national park entrance to the villas at the end of the peninsula towards Tamarindo.
Beach was fine enough to walk in - lots of shells and surfers. Water wasn't cold, but wasn't totally warm either, comfortable temperature to walk.
If you walk down to the end of the peninsula, water taxis that are only $2 will take you over to Tamarindo, so in the end it's nice to be a bit secluded away from the action, yet still have access to shopping and entertainment if you need it. Just wave to the guys at the other end!

To get to Tamarindo there are little boats that cross the river until 5 pm. Around noon we were able to walk across the river, while in the evening it is not possible because of the high tide.
